The structural composition of fluid tracking technology is highly diverse, featuring an array of unique hardware designs engineered to handle specific physical environments, fluid viscosities, and conductivity profiles. Because no single measurement method works perfectly across all industrial applications, the market is highly fragmented into specialized sub-categories. For instance, electromagnetic meters are highly favored in water management due to their ability to measure conductive liquids without obstructing fluid flow. On the other hand, ultrasonic variations are experiencing surging popularity because they use acoustic waves to track fluids externally, completely avoiding direct contact with corrosive chemicals.

For example, differential pressure systems remain a staple in high-pressure oil and gas applications due to their long history of reliability and rugged construction. However, younger formats like thermal mass sensors are rapidly gaining ground in semiconductor manufacturing, where tracking ultra-low gas volumes with high precision is vital. Why are ultrasonic tracking units gaining market share over traditional inline mechanical meters in chemical processing? Ultrasonic units measure fluid velocity externally using acoustic waves, meaning they do not require cutting into pipes or making physical contact with corrosive chemicals. This non-invasive approach eliminates physical component wear, prevents pressure drops, and slashes long-term maintenance costs.

In what specific scenarios do electromagnetic metering systems outperform other fluid measurement technologies? Electromagnetic systems excel when tracking the flow of conductive liquids, such as water, wastewater, and slurries, especially when those fluids contain suspended solids. Because they feature an open-bore design with no internal obstructions, they are highly resistant to clogging and introduce zero pressure drops into the pipeline.
